Pella Windows and Doors Hours of Operation and Locations in Belmar, NJ
- 1 Locations in Belmar
- www.pella.com
- Pella Windows and Doors Hours
- Category: Home & Garden
-
1985 Rt-34View Store Details
(888) 678-9488
Explore BelmarView More
-
Apparel
Carter's
Catherines
Avenue
Delia's
Express
-
Sports
Vans
West Marine
Jazzercise
Delia's
-
Jewelry
Avon